Sensex climbs 100 pts, Nifty50 above 10,450; Dr Reddy's Labs, RCom drop 3% each

NEW DELHI: Benchmark indices opened on a firm footing on Wednesday tracking a higher opening for Asian markets to near decade high levels. US stocks had closed at record high level in overnight trade.

At 9.22 am, the BSE barometer Sensex was trading 103.44 points, or 0.31 per cent, higher at 33,915.70. Mid and smallcap indices gained up to 0.7 per cent.

Nifty50 was ruling at 10,467.65, up 24.45 points, or 0.24 per cent.

Rajesh Palviya, Head - Technical & Derivatives Analyst at Axis Securities noted that the prevailing 10,460-10,480 range still remains a supply zone.

"Traders are repeatedly advised to be selective and avoid taking undue risk in the market as the volatility may continue to scale up," Angel Broking said in a note.

Among Sensex stocks, ICICI Bank gained 1.79 per cent to Rs 314.80 on BSE. Shares of Reliance Industries advanced 1.16 epr cent to Rs 921.95 after the refiner commissioned and achieved design throughput of the world's first ever and largest Refinery Off-Gas Cracker (ROGC) complex of 1.5 MMTPA capacity along with downstream plants and utilities.

Adani Ports rose 1.01 per cent to Rs 400.80, while SBI, Sun Pharma, Bharti Airtel and Tata Steel added up to 0.9 per cent.

Dr Reddy's Labs declined 2.98 per cent to Rs 2336.05. ONGC, HDFC Bank, Tata Motors and Infosys fell up to 0.86 per cent.

Apar Industries gained 3 per cent after the entered into a Joint venture agreement with PPS Motors for the purpose incorporated a company in the name of 'Ampoil Apar Lubricants' (AALPL). AALPL will market Lubricants in the AMPOIL brand, a brand owned by PPS Business Solutions.

Dixon Technologies rose 3.26 per cent to Rs 4,268.65. AIL Dixon Technologies, a Joint Venture Company of Dixon Technologies (India) ('the Company') has commenced manufacturing of CCTVs and DVRs under the Trademark "CP Plus" on 2 January, 2018 from its manufacturing facility situated at Tirupati.
